Progression And/or Retention Criteria:

6 Figure Healthcare Careers NO ONE Talks About (No M.D)
  • Grades in Prerequisite Courses: A graduate student needs to achieve a passing grade in a pre-requisite course in order to progress to the next course. Passing is considered a grade of B or higher.
  • Grades in Required Courses: To progress toward the graduate degree in Nursing, students must successfully pass the clinical portion of all clinical/practicum courses. In addition, students must earn a minimum grade of B in all courses required in the program. Grades of B- or below are not acceptable.
  • If a student receives a grade below a B in any course in the approved program of studies, this course must be repeated the next time it is offered.
  • All clinical/practicum experiences with the preceptor will be graded on a pass/fail basis by course faculty. A student must pass the clinical/practicum component of the clinical course in order to pass the course regardless of the theory grade earned in the course.
  • A course may be repeated only once.
  • If any graduate student receives two grades below a B in the same course or in more than one course, he or she will be dismissed from the program.
  • Progression/Graduation requirements: A graduate student must earn a cumulative course grade of a B or higher and in all courses to successfully complete the program.
  • If a student receives a cumulative course grade lower than a B, the student will receive an academic warning. A student may be placed on academic warning/probation only once during the program of study.

    Frequent Nursing Resume Errors

    Nurse Practioner Resume Samples

    Unfortunately, many candidates make simple, avoidable mistakes on their resume that can automatically have them rejected for a position. Recruiters, hiring managers, and HR personnel are looking for reasons to narrow the pool of applicants and resumes. Simple errors are an easy way to do that. Thats why one of the most important aspects of learning how to write a nursing resume is to identify common mistakes. These include:

    • Irrelevant information, such as hobbies
    • Poor job descriptions
    • Lacking a cover letter when available
    • Using an unprofessional email address
    • References or the line References Upon Request
    • Adding salary desired or current salary
    • Adding personal information

    Another mistake is having only one resume. This is especially true for entry-level nurses who havent yet found a specialty and apply to a wide variety of positions. Make small changes to your resume to target specific positions. You might reworking your summary, move up and highlight relevant experience, or list skills related to that role.

    Awards Honors Or Achievements

    Dont hide your achievements! Make sure to list all awards and honors that are relevant. You should also share some details about who gives the award or what you did to earn it. For experienced nurses, this can go higher on your resume, even directly under your summary. That way, the recruiter or hiring manager will be enticed to continue reading. Entry-level nurses may not have as many professional accomplishments, so the section can be lower on the page. But be sure to mention awards you won in school, such as graduating with honors, top of your class, or anything else that can set you apart.

    Add A Resume Summary Or Objective Section

    As with most resumes, it’s usually best that you start an entry-level nurse practitioner resume with a summary or objective. A summary showcases your previous relevant achievements, while an objective states what you’re hoping to achieve in the future. Whichever you choose, it may be easier to write it after you write everything else, as you’ll have your own resume as a guide.
